Zoi Market & Meridian Cafe on Main St. in Buda is worth the journey. If you have ever been to ABC Carpet in Manhattan, it has the same feeling - where you are lured by beautiful things into every corner, it's not a market its an experience. There are speciality items you can't find anywhere else, it's meticulously curated: rare plants, luxurious robes, the highest quality food items, both prepared and pantry: grass fed elk, pressed juices, and Teal House in the back of the store serves a croissants that rival those in Paris, ask them about how they are made. Meridian Cafe connects to the Market from inside where they serve mocktails with adaptogens and herbs targeted towards healing specific parts of the body. I never have high expectations for mocktails - but like everything else it's clear that there was a lot of thought, love, and trial that went into their drinks, and perhaps even a mixologist. The interior plan was designed in a way that invites personal connection: a full bar, community tables, and an intimate stage for live performances. Zoi Market has a bar of tinctures lining it's far wall, which is connected to Zoi Medicinals a building two minutes down the street which offers acupuncture and herbal medicine. I almost never write reviews, but this is an oasis of sorts that I found when I just arrived in Buda and it felt like home, a place with all of 'my favorite things'. so thank you to Noa and Travis Sutherland for your vision.

Zoi Market isn’t just a marketplace - it’s a vibrant cultural space that brings together several unique local businesses, creating a cozy, creative, and community-driven atmosphere. Inside, you’ll find Teal House Bakery, offering fresh pastries, and Meridian Coffee Bar, which has quickly become one of our favorite spots. The ability to grab a morning croissant in one part of the market, order a coffee in another, and then find a comfortable space to relax makes this place truly special. Beyond food and coffee, Zoi Market also features a vintage clothing store, where you can discover unique pieces with character, and Essential Muscle, catering to fitness enthusiasts. Several other small businesses add to the charm, making this space a perfect blend of food, style, and local craftsmanship. Whether you’re here for a quick coffee, a leisurely breakfast, or just to explore, Zoi Market is a place worth experiencing. Highly recommended!

So happy I discovered this little corner of joy in so many ways. Since moving to Texas, this has become one of my favorite spots. Not only are there great unique items for gifts and well let's admit, for myself, But it's a hub of community with fabulous food and snacks from Teal House, Delicious hot and cold drinks from Meridian (the connected coffee shop), fantastic herbal tinctures from Zoi Medicinals. The coffee shop hosts musicians, and open mic nights on a regular basis. And they just added a lovely backyard deck, with more changes on the horizon. This spot is only 18 minutes from my home in South Austin. I go at least once a week. Austinites, check it out!

As long as I can remember I have had issues sleeping. I have ADHD, and as with most ADHDers, we can’t go to sleep or have problems staying asleep. Through the years, I have tried everything from prescribed medications that give me hangovers the next day or things like melatonin or CBD, that only work for so long. When Zoi’s first opened, my husband and I went in to show local support and I came across their “Sleep” tincture. I figured it would be like everything else but I was willing to try anything. I’ve been taking it nightly for a year now. It is the first time I have been able to go back to sleep after waking up during the night. I have turned some ADHDers onto it and they have had the same results. Either it helps them go to sleep and stay asleep or they are able to go back to sleep if woken up. I highly recommend it! It’s natural, made in house, and it works!

They have many other tinctures for various things. Just ask the highly knowledgeable staff!
